Is that zero-banded, yellow shell snail a cepaea hortensis? The lip looks white, but I can't really tell if it's hard or not.

Is that zero-banded, yellow shell snail a cepaea hortensis? The lip looks white, but I can't really tell if it's hard or not. It's white-rimmed, so hortensis, but I won't wager the farm that it won't grow a dark rim later!

Ebony and Sheldon got amorous a couple of days ago and poor Sheldon took a love dart to the face. The little fellow has been hiding in his shell since! Maybe he is writing poems.
Meanwhile, some other snailie dug up a little chamber and laid about 20 eggs. I don't recall seeing a preggo snail! I wonder where the eggs are stowed away in their bodies before being laid. The eggs are so white and pearly, it's like a little miracle of life.
